They asked 80 college students to fill out a survey indicating their attitudes on a wide variety of topics. Sometime later they were shown the attitudes of a "stranger" responding to the same questions the participants had answered earlier. The strangers answers were actually made up by the researcher to vary with the attitudes of the participants. The participants were then asked how attracted they would be to the strangers, based on the answers to the survey questions. If opposites truly attract then the participants should be attracted to the strangers who shared the least about of similar attitudes with the participant. What is the SPSS test that you should use to conduct this analysis? (for example Anova, t-test)
